A New Book For Paper 2, World History Topic 12: The Cold War: Superpower Tensions And Rivalries (20Th Century) Readable And Rigorous Coverage That Gives You The Depth Of Knowledge And Skills Development Required For The Diploma. Provides: Reliable, Clear And Indepth Narrative From Topic Experts Analysis Of The Historiography Surrounding Key Debates Dedicated Exam Practice With Model Answers And Practice Questions Tok Support Activities And Historical Investigation Questions To Help With All Aspects Of The Diploma Tailored Exactly To The Diploma, It Also Helps You Develop Analytical Skills Through The Widest Variety Of Sources At This Level. Other Titles In The Series: The Move To Global War Rights And Protest Authoritarian States
